nodejs學習(二)--express熱更新nodemon,自啟動專案
一、說一下
每次修改檔案,我們都需要重啟伺服器npm start,很麻煩,所以使用引入nodemon外掛,解決這個問題,實現儲存檔案,即自啟動重新整理專案
二、直接開碼
npm install nodemon -g --save-dev
註釋:
-g:全域性安裝nodemon
--save-dev:安裝到本專案的dev開發環境依賴下
新增nodemon.json檔案
nodemon.json程式碼如下:
{ "restartable": "rs", "ignore": [ ".git", ".svn", "node_modules/**/node_modules" ], "verbose": true, "execMap": { "js": "node --harmony" }, "watch": [ ], "env": { "NODE_ENV": "development" }, "ext": "js json" }
配置完成,執行
nodemon app
成功,開始監聽...
當我們修改檔案,儲存之後,後臺會自動重啟伺服器,我們只需要F5重新整理瀏覽器即可看到修改的效果。
三、最後
有時候也會出現自啟動不太好使的情況,伺服器沒有自動重啟,所以導致重新整理頁面沒有效果,這時候,可以試著在命令列介面,按一下ctrl+c,會觸發監聽,伺服器會自動重啟。
現在,框架搭建完畢,可以直接開始寫頁面了,但是頁面需要資料,這時可以在寫頁面之前,把資料準備好,所以我們需要連線到資料庫去獲取我們需要的資料。